Output 2e0c61672f934d630441272e2461fc1943453e5a6a8cee90a5f306827a39d393:122

value
9391520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33a1a7b16c669a80519f71684fef4d26c0e7d19e OP_EQUAL
address
36Q23KLWLD5QVEqNfE8pJJPfcvJNwKh2qQ
transaction
2e0c61672f934d630441272e2461fc1943453e5a6a8cee90a5f306827a39d393